Not an industrial strength test but... I predominantly take B & W TMAX100 Readyloads but like to carry some colour film around with me for occasional use. Over the last few weeks I have now put 20 Fuji Provia F100 through the Kodak single sheet holder without any problems. Likewise I found that the kodak sheets did not work in the Fuji holder.

However... for the sake of the extra space of the holder I think I agree with a previous poster who said take both... depends on your mix of B & W and Colour.
